数据库语言主要功能有什么

飞飞 其他 2

回复

共3条回复 我来回复
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    数据库语言是一种用于管理和操作数据库的编程语言。它具有许多功能,使用户能够有效地管理和操作数据库。以下是数据库语言的主要功能:

    1. 数据定义语言(DDL):DDL用于定义数据库的结构,包括创建、修改和删除数据库对象(例如表、视图、索引等)。DDL语句主要包括CREATE、ALTER和DROP等。

    2. 数据查询语言(DQL):DQL用于从数据库中检索数据。它允许用户使用各种条件和关键字来查询数据,以满足特定的需求。DQL语句主要包括SELECT、FROM、WHERE等。

    3. 数据操作语言(DML):DML用于对数据库中的数据进行增删改操作。它允许用户插入新数据、更新现有数据和删除数据。DML语句主要包括INSERT、UPDATE和DELETE等。

    4. 数据控制语言(DCL):DCL用于控制数据库的访问权限和安全性。它允许用户授予或撤销对数据库对象的访问权限,并管理用户的身份验证和授权。DCL语句主要包括GRANT、REVOKE和DENY等。

    5. 事务控制语言(TCL):TCL用于管理数据库中的事务。它允许用户开始、提交或回滚事务,以确保数据库的一致性和完整性。TCL语句主要包括BEGIN、COMMIT和ROLLBACK等。

    除了以上功能之外,数据库语言还可以提供其他辅助功能,例如数据类型转换、数据排序、数据分组和聚合等。它还可以支持复杂的查询操作,例如连接、子查询和视图等。总之,数据库语言是数据库管理系统中必不可少的工具,它使用户能够轻松地管理和操作数据库。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库语言是一种用于管理和操作数据库的编程语言。它提供了一组命令和语法,用于创建、查询、更新和删除数据库中的数据。数据库语言的主要功能包括:

    1. 数据定义语言(DDL):DDL用于定义数据库的结构和组织方式。它包括创建、修改和删除数据库、表、视图、索引、约束等对象的命令。常见的DDL命令有CREATE、ALTER和DROP。

    2. 数据操作语言(DML):DML用于对数据库中的数据进行操作。它包括插入、查询、更新和删除数据的命令。常见的DML命令有SELECT、INSERT、UPDATE和DELETE。

    3. 数据查询语言(DQL):DQL用于从数据库中检索数据。它提供了灵活的查询语法,可以根据条件过滤和排序数据。常见的DQL命令是SELECT。

    4. 事务控制语言(TCL):TCL用于管理数据库中的事务。它包括开始事务、提交事务和回滚事务的命令。常见的TCL命令有BEGIN、COMMIT和ROLLBACK。

    5. 数据控制语言(DCL):DCL用于管理数据库中的用户权限和安全性。它包括授权和撤销权限的命令,以及创建和管理用户的命令。常见的DCL命令有GRANT、REVOKE和CREATE USER。

    除了以上主要功能,数据库语言还可以支持其他高级功能,如存储过程、触发器、视图等。存储过程是一段预先编译好的代码,可以作为一个单元执行,提高了数据库的执行效率。触发器是一种特殊的存储过程,可以在特定的数据库操作(如插入、更新、删除)发生时自动执行。视图是虚拟的表,可以根据查询条件从一个或多个表中获取数据。

    总之,数据库语言的主要功能包括定义数据库结构、操作数据库数据、查询数据库数据、管理事务和权限等。这些功能使得数据库能够有效地存储和管理大量的数据,并提供灵活的数据访问和控制能力。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库语言是用于管理和操作数据库的一种编程语言。它可以通过执行特定的命令或语句来实现对数据库的增删改查操作,从而实现对数据的存储、检索和更新。数据库语言的主要功能包括以下几个方面:

    1. 数据定义语言(DDL):DDL用于定义数据库的结构,包括创建、修改和删除数据库、表、视图、索引、触发器等对象。常用的DDL命令有CREATE、ALTER和DROP。

    2. 数据操纵语言(DML):DML用于对数据库中的数据进行增删改操作,包括插入、更新和删除数据。常用的DML命令有INSERT、UPDATE和DELETE。

    3. 数据查询语言(DQL):DQL用于从数据库中检索数据,包括查询、排序和过滤数据。常用的DQL命令有SELECT、ORDER BY和WHERE。

    4. 事务控制语言(TCL):TCL用于控制数据库中的事务,包括开始、提交和回滚事务。常用的TCL命令有BEGIN、COMMIT和ROLLBACK。

    5. 数据控制语言(DCL):DCL用于定义和管理数据库中的用户权限和安全性,包括创建、修改和删除用户、授权和撤销权限。常用的DCL命令有GRANT、REVOKE和CREATE USER。

    6. 数据库嵌入式语言(SQL/PSM):SQL/PSM是基于SQL的过程化编程语言,可以在数据库中定义和执行存储过程、函数和触发器等数据库对象。

    以上是数据库语言的主要功能,通过使用这些功能,可以对数据库进行全面的管理和操作,实现数据的有效存储和高效检索。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部